Operating with 40 degrees downbite, this Ferris‑Smith‑Kerrison accesses the inferior vertebral endplate and foraminal bone during anterior diskectomy and fusion. The thin footplate reduces field obstruction, while the 4mm bite enables controlled incremental removal. The 230mm working length suits extended lower cervical and thoracic approaches.
Features & Benefits
- 40 degrees downbite for inferior endplate and foramen access
- 4mm bite provides controlled bone fragmentation
- Thin footplate minimizes field obstruction
- 230mm working length supports extended exposures
